Objective:
Over the years, the subject has been of controversy since the IUPAC
Recommendations made in 1985 that left two "definitions" of pH as acceptable
(ref.1). In 1997, a proposal was made to initiate
a new working party to develop a single definition of pH.
Ref.1. Pure Appl. Chem. 57(3),
531-542 (1985)
Progress:
The program formally began with a working Meeting at the Univ. of
Durham, England in Spring 1998. An outline was proposed after agreement
on, and resolution of the devisive issues contained in the 1985 Compromise
Document on pH and pH Standards. An outline for the new pH Document
was accepted at a second meeting of the Working Party, mainly after
removal of possible topics, such non-aqueous solvent pH, and pH in biological
media that were saved for later IUPAC documents or journal publications.
The metrological concepts of traceability to SI units, and ranking of
measurement methods and materials according to statistical analyses
of reproducibility and accuracy were the important new concepts not
emphasized in the earlier document. Error analyses of liquid junction
potential differences and ion size parameter variation in the Bates-Guggenheim
convention for activity coefficients were two of many new features of
the work.
Early drafts of text and calculations for inclusion as Tables were
discussed at a third Meeting in Milan, Spring 1999. A public presentation
of the draft document was given at the Berlin IUPAC Assembly in August
1999 by Prof. S. Rondinini. Comments were received by members of the
Party and used to prepare a modified new draft with input from most
WP Members. The resulting draft will be submitted to IUPAC relevant
Commissions and Division Committee by the end of December 1999.
A final document is submitted to public review comments until 31 January
2002 > see provisional
recommendations
Project completed - IUPAC Recommendations 2002 published
in Pure
Appl. Chem.
74(11), 2169-2200, 2002.
A review of the recommendations was prepared by F.G.K Baucke and published
in Anal. Bioanal. Chem. (2002)374:772-777
